Free breakfast and lunch will continue for both in school students and curbside participants through June 30, 2021.
Meal Service Week of Feb 22 - 26 Free curbside community meals for all children between the ages of 1 - 18 will be available for pick up at the below listed sites from 4:00 pm - 5:00 pm on Tuesday, Feb. 23 & Friday Feb. 26:
- Central Middle School- 12801 L Street
- Millard North High School- 1010 South 144th Street
- Millard South High School- 14905 Q Street
- Millard West High School- 5710 South 176th Street
Tuesday 2/23 Pick Up Curbside Community Order Form- order cutoff time will be 5:00 pm on Monday 2/22. Breakfast and lunch will be provided for Feb.17 - 19.
Friday 2/26 Pick Up Curbside Community Order Form- order cutoff time will be 5:00 pm on Thursday 2/25. Breakfast and lunch will be provided for Feb. 20 - 23.
An individual submission must be submitted for each child requesting a meal. If you have any questions please call 402-715-1440.
Free weekend meal kits for in school students can be pre ordered by Thursday 2/25 by 5:00 pm through the weekend meal kit order form. The weekend meal kits will provide breakfast and lunch for Saturday & Sunday. Students can pick up their meal kits at the end of the school day on Friday, Feb. 26 as they exit the school building.

New COVID-19 Web Page
Keeping our community informed about the ongoing response to COVID-19 is a district priority. The district COVID-19 web page has been redesigned. It can be found in the same place, on the first page of our district website. You may also click here to reach it directly. Along with safety and response protocols, the page also tracks the virus within our district. It shows current active cases of COVID-19 and current district quarantines, plus the number of active cases per building. The information is updated each weekday morning.
